Luminously

Luminous \Lu"mi*nous\, a. [L. luminosus, fr. lumen light: cf. F. lumineux. See Luminary, Illuminate.]

  1. Shining; emitting or reflecting light; brilliant; bright; as, the is a luminous body; a luminous color.

    Fire burneth wood, making it . . . luminous.
    --Bacon.

    The mountains lift . . . their lofty and luminous heads.
    --Longfellow.

  2. Illuminated; full of light; bright; as, many candles made the room luminous.

    Up the staircase moved a luminous space in the darkness.
    --Longfellow.

  3. Enlightened; intelligent; also, clear; intelligible; as, a luminous mind. `` Luminous eloquence.''
    --Macaulay. `` A luminous statement.''
    --Brougham.

    Luminous paint, a paint made up with some phosphorescent substance, as sulphide of calcium, which after exposure to a strong light is luminous in the dark for a time.

    Syn: Lucid; clear; shining; perspicuous. [1913 Webster] -- Lu"mi*nous*ly, adv. -- Lu"mi*nous*ness, n.

Wiktionary
luminously

adv. In a luminous manner, brightly, glowingly.
